Alabama Bust Charges 3 With Making Illegal Moonshine

HURTSBORO, Ala. (AP) – State authorities have charged three men with operating an illegal moonshine still in Alabama. Investigators with the Alabama Law Enforcement Agency made the arrests after discovering a 48-barrel still in rural Russell County. Andalusia Health Not Allowing Hospital Visitors

Andalusia Health has announced that it will no longer permit visitors to its hospital, effective today at 5PM. It says it wants to help ensure the safety of its patients, providers, employees and community. The policy is in effect until further notice. State ABC Board Temporarily Closing 41 Stores Due to COVID-19 Pandemic

The Alabama Alcoholic Beverage Control Board  is temporarily closing 41 ABC stores across the state, effective January 16.
